TUNA QUESADILLA
Make and share this Tuna Quesadilla recipe from Food.com.
Provided by Lorac
Categories Tuna
Time 15m
Yield 3 quesadillas
Number Of Ingredients 5
Steps:
- Combine tuna, mayo and salsa.
- Spread 3 tortillas with the tuna mixture, top with cheese and cover with remaining tortillas.
- Lightly grease a non stick skillet, add the quesadillas, one at a time and cook until lightly browned.
- Turn and cook until cheese has melted.
TUNA QUESADILLA
Provided by Robert Irvine : Food Network
Categories appetizer
Time 15m
Yield 12 wedges
Number Of Ingredients 5
Steps:
- Mix tuna with salsa and scallions. Fold in Cheddar. Divide mixture into 1/3's and spread each portion over 1/2 of a tortilla and fold into a half circle. Brown each of the 3 quesadillas on both sides in a hot pan to melt cheese. Cool a bit, cut into wedges and serve.
CHARLIE'S TUNA MELT QUESADILLA
Provided by Food Network
Time 12m
Yield 2
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- In a medium bowl, combine tuna, celery, relish, mayonnaise and lemon juice and mix well.
- Spray small frying pan with non-stick cooking spray. Heat over medium low heat. Place tortilla in pan. Place 1/2 tuna mixture on one half of each tortilla and top with 1/4 cup cheddar cheese and top with second tortilla.
- Cook for 1 - 2 minutes until tortilla begins to brown; flip tortilla and cook on second side until browned and cheese begins to bubble (approximately 1 - 2 minutes).
- Remove from pan and cut into wedges and serve.
